JD Vance’s Pivotal India Visit: Strengthening US-India Trade Amidst Global Shifts

The recent visit of US Vice President JD Vance to India has sparked significant attention, particularly his high-level meeting with Prime Minister Narendra Modi. This encounter, held at a critical juncture in global economics, has underscored the deepening strategic and economic ties between the United States and India. The core focus of their discussions centered on accelerating a bilateral trade deal, a move seen as crucial for both nations amidst the ongoing US-China trade tensions.

The Crucial Trade Deal: A Win-Win Scenario

The heart of the Modi-Vance meeting lay in the advanced stage of talks regarding a bilateral trade deal. This deal is envisioned as a “win-win” scenario, aiming to create mutual benefits by reducing trade barriers and fostering economic cooperation. The backdrop to these discussions is the US-China trade war, which has created significant uncertainties in the global market.

Tariff Dynamics and Timelines

President Trump’s decision to impose a 26 percent tariff on Indian goods, in addition to the existing 10 percent, had initially created friction. However, the subsequent “pause” on these “reciprocal” tariffs for 90 days has been interpreted by economists as a window of opportunity to finalize the trade deal.

Initially, Indian officials had anticipated the trade deal to be completed by autumn. However, there’s a growing push to expedite the process, with some suggesting a target completion date by the end of July, before the peak monsoon season. More recently some sources have indicated a goal to complete the deal by the end of May.

India’s Stance: Independence and Mutual Respect

India has maintained a firm stance throughout these negotiations, emphasizing that it will not be rushed into a deal. New Delhi has made it clear that any agreement must address India’s concerns and priorities. The phrase “at gunpoint” has been used to convey India’s resolve to negotiate on its own terms, ensuring that the deal reflects a true partnership based on mutual respect and benefit.

Civil-Nuclear Cooperation: A Major Breakthrough

A significant development in the India-US partnership has been the breakthrough in civil-nuclear cooperation. The US Department of Energy’s final approval, permitting a US company to jointly design and build nuclear power plants in India, marks a major milestone. Holtec International, owned by Indian-American entrepreneur Krishna P Singh, has been granted the license for this project. Its Asia subsidiary, Holtec Asia, headquartered in Pune, has been operating in India since 2010.

Reducing Dependence on China: India as an Alternative

US firms are also exploring opportunities to invest in India’s electronics manufacturing sector, particularly for gadgets like laptops, tablets, and mobiles. This move is aimed at reducing dependence on China and establishing India as a viable alternative in the global supply chain. India’s existing strength in mobile manufacturing positions it as a strategic partner in this endeavor.
